About Tradeweb Markets Class A

Tradeweb Markets Inc. (Tradeweb) is a leading global provider of electronic trading platforms for fixed income, equities, and derivatives. The company operates a multi-asset class trading platform that provides institutional investors with access to a wide range of financial instruments, including bonds, swaps, and other derivatives. Tradeweb's technology platform enables its users to execute trades efficiently and securely, while also providing access to real-time market data and analytics.


Tradeweb's business model is based on providing a neutral and transparent trading environment for its clients. The company earns revenue from transaction fees, data subscriptions, and other services. Tradeweb's commitment to innovation and its focus on serving the needs of institutional investors has made it a trusted partner in the global financial markets.

Assessing Tradeweb's Potential Risks: A Look at the Future

Tradeweb operates in a highly competitive landscape, facing threats from established financial institutions, technology firms venturing into financial services, and emerging market disruptors. The company's growth hinges on maintaining its technological edge and adapting to evolving market dynamics. If Tradeweb fails to innovate and enhance its platform's capabilities, it could lose market share to competitors with more advanced offerings. Moreover, the financial services sector is inherently susceptible to regulatory changes and market volatility. Any significant regulatory shift or economic downturn could negatively impact Tradeweb's business and profitability.


Tradeweb's revenue model relies on transaction fees, exposing it to fluctuations in market activity and trading volumes. If market conditions deteriorate or investors reduce their trading activity, Tradeweb's revenue stream could be affected. Additionally, Tradeweb's business is concentrated in a few key financial markets, making it susceptible to region-specific economic challenges. For instance, a decline in the US or European markets could significantly impact Tradeweb's performance.


Cybersecurity threats pose a significant risk to Tradeweb's operations. The company's platform handles sensitive financial data, making it a prime target for cyberattacks. A successful cyberattack could lead to data breaches, operational disruptions, reputational damage, and financial losses. Tradeweb must continually invest in robust cybersecurity measures to mitigate these risks. Moreover, Tradeweb's reliance on third-party providers for certain services and infrastructure creates potential vulnerabilities. Any disruption or failure in these third-party services could disrupt Tradeweb's operations.
